How to make Oven Baked Beef Tacos:
Step one: Start by preheating your oven to 400 degrees F. Prepare a casserole dish by lightly spraying cooking spray and then placing taco shells standing up into the dish.
Tip: Use a 3 quart casserole dish.
Step two:Next cook and crumble ground beef in a skillet. Once it's fully cooked drain the fat and then add your salsa, taco seasoning, and rinsed and drained black beans. Mix together well on low heat until heated through.
Step three: Once your filling is prepared go ahead and spoon this bean and beef mixture to each taco. Top each taco with shredded cheese and bake for 8-10 minutes or until cheese is melted and taco shells cooked.
Tip: To hep your tacos to stand when filling I use a taco shell with a flat bottom.
Step four: Remove from oven and top shredded lettuce and diced tomatoes or your favorite taco toppings.

Oven Baked Beef Tacos
Jennie Duncan
Taco anything is my favorite! TheseOven Baked Beef Tacos are simple to make and make the perfect recipe for feeding a crowd!
5 from 3 votes
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 25 minutes mins
Cook Time 10 minutes mins
Total Time 35 minutes mins
Course Main Course
Cuisine American, Mexican
Servings 8 servings
Calories 275 kcal
Ingredients
- 8 stand taco shells
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 cup salsa
- 1 tablespoon taco seasoning
- 15 oz black beans (rinsed and drained)
- 1 ½ cups taco blend shredded cheese
- 1 cup lettuce (shredded)
- 1 cup tomatoes (diced)
Instructions
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Prepare a casserole dish by lightly spraying cooking spray and then placing taco shells standing up into the dish.
Cook and crumble ground beef in a skillet. Once fully cooked drain fat Add salsa, taco seasoning, and rinsed and drained black beans. Mix together well on low heat until heated through.
Spoon bean and beef mixture to each taco. Top each taco with shredded cheese and bake for 8-10 minutes or until cheese is melted and taco shells cooked.
Remove from oven and top shredded lettuce and diced tomatoes or your favorite taco toppings.
